网络信息采集软件如何应对数据采集技术难题?
在当今信息爆炸的时代,网络信息采集软件已经成为企业、机构和个人获取信息的利器。然而,随着数据量的不断增长和采集技术的日益复杂,网络信息采集软件面临着诸多技术难题。本文将深入探讨网络信息采集软件如何应对这些技术难题,以帮助读者更好地了解这一领域。
一、数据采集技术难题
- 数据质量难题
网络信息采集软件在采集数据时,往往会遇到数据质量不高的问题。例如,数据重复、错误、缺失等现象严重影响了数据的价值。为了提高数据质量,网络信息采集软件需要采取以下措施:
(1)采用数据清洗技术,对采集到的数据进行去重、纠错、补缺等处理。
(2)引入数据验证机制,确保采集到的数据符合既定标准。
(3)建立数据质量评估体系,定期对数据质量进行监控和评估。
- 数据采集速度难题
随着网络信息的快速增长,数据采集速度成为制约网络信息采集软件性能的关键因素。为了提高数据采集速度,可以从以下几个方面入手:
(1)优化算法,提高数据采集效率。
(2)采用分布式采集技术,实现多节点并行采集。
(3)引入缓存机制,减少重复采集。
- 数据采集范围难题
网络信息采集软件在采集数据时,往往受到采集范围的限制。为了扩大采集范围,可以采取以下措施:
(1)采用多种采集方式,如网页采集、API采集、数据库采集等。
(2)拓展采集渠道,如社交媒体、论坛、博客等。
(3)与第三方数据提供商合作,获取更多数据资源。
- 数据采集成本难题
数据采集成本是制约网络信息采集软件发展的关键因素之一。为了降低数据采集成本,可以从以下几个方面入手:
(1)优化算法,提高数据采集效率,降低人力成本。
(2)采用开源技术,降低软件开发成本。
(3)合理配置硬件资源,降低硬件采购成本。
二、网络信息采集软件应对技术难题的策略
- 技术创新
(1)研发新型数据采集算法,提高数据采集效率。
(2)引入人工智能、大数据等技术,实现智能化数据采集。
(3)开发高性能采集引擎,提高数据采集速度。
- 产品优化
(1)优化用户界面,提高用户体验。
(2)丰富功能模块,满足不同用户需求。
(3)加强数据分析功能,提升数据价值。
- 合作共赢
(1)与数据提供商、技术合作伙伴建立合作关系,共同推进技术发展。
(2)积极参与行业标准制定,推动行业健康发展。
(3)开展技术交流,分享经验,共同提高。
- 案例分析
以某知名网络信息采集软件为例,该软件通过以下措施应对数据采集技术难题:
(1)采用分布式采集技术,实现多节点并行采集,提高数据采集速度。
(2)引入数据清洗技术,对采集到的数据进行去重、纠错、补缺等处理,提高数据质量。
(3)与第三方数据提供商合作,获取更多数据资源,扩大采集范围。
(4)优化算法,提高数据采集效率,降低数据采集成本。
通过以上措施,该网络信息采集软件在数据采集领域取得了显著成果,赢得了广大用户的认可。
总之,网络信息采集软件在应对数据采集技术难题方面,需要不断创新、优化产品、加强合作。随着技术的不断发展,网络信息采集软件将更好地服务于各行各业,助力信息时代的发展。
猜你喜欢:服务调用链